Advertisement
grzesiek11

overviewer marker error

Jul 22nd, 2019
172
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 2.83 KB | None | 0 0
  1. grzesiek11@starypc:~/servers/mc$ overviewer --skip-scan --genpoi -c markers.conf
  2. 2019-07-22 11:23:37 Initialized an empty UUID cache.
  3. 2019-07-22 11:23:37 E An error has occurred. This may be a bug. Please let us know!
  4. See http://docs.overviewer.org/en/latest/index.html#help
  5.  
  6. This is the error that occurred:
  7. Traceback (most recent call last):
  8. File "/home/grzesiek11/Programy/path/overviewer", line 650, in <module>
  9. ret = main()
  10. File "/home/grzesiek11/Programy/path/overviewer", line 168, in main
  11. g.genPOI.main()
  12. File "/home/grzesiek11/Programy/overviewer/overviewer_core/aux_files/genPOI.py", line 557, in main
  13. handlePlayers(worldpath, list(worldpath_filters), markers)
  14. File "/home/grzesiek11/Programy/overviewer/overviewer_core/aux_files/genPOI.py", line 361, in handlePlayers
  15. result = filter_function(data)
  16. File "markers.conf", line 7, in placeFilter
  17. return poi['name']
  18. File "/home/grzesiek11/Programy/overviewer/overviewer_core/aux_files/genPOI.py", line 270, in __getitem__
  19. return super(PlayerDict, self).__getitem__(item)
  20. KeyError: 'name'
  21. grzesiek11@starypc:~/servers/mc$ cd
  22. grzesiek11@starypc:~$ cat ~/servers/mc/markers.conf
  23. def playerIcons(poi):
  24. if poi['id'] == 'Player':
  25. poi['icon'] = "https://overviewer.org/avatar/%s" % poi['EntityId']
  26. return "Last known location for %s" % poi['EntityId']
  27.  
  28. def placeFilter(poi):
  29. return poi['name']
  30.  
  31. worlds["survival"] = "/home/grzesiek11/servers/mc/world"
  32. outputdir = "/var/www/html/server/mcmap-test"
  33.  
  34. renders['survivalday'] = {
  35. 'world': 'survival',
  36. 'title': 'Survival Daytime',
  37. 'manualpois': [
  38. {'id':'Base',
  39. 'x':200,
  40. 'y':64,
  41. 'z':200,
  42. 'name':'Foo'},
  43. {'id':'Base',
  44. 'x':-300,
  45. 'y':85,
  46. 'z':-234,
  47. 'name':'Bar'}],
  48. 'markers': [dict(name="Bases", filterFunction=placeFilter),
  49. dict(name="Players", filterFunction=playerIcons)]
  50. }
  51.  
  52. renders['survivalnight'] = {
  53. 'world': 'survival',
  54. 'title': 'Survival Nighttime',
  55. 'manualpois': renders['survivalday']['manualpois'],
  56. 'markers': renders['survivalday']['markers']
  57. }
  58.  
  59. renders['survivalnether'] = {
  60. 'world': 'survival',
  61. 'title': 'Survival Nether',
  62. 'manualpois': [
  63. {'id':'Portal',
  64. 'x':200,
  65. 'y':64,
  66. 'z':200,
  67. 'name':'Foo'},
  68. {'id':'Portal',
  69. 'x':-300,
  70. 'y':85,
  71. 'z':-234,
  72. 'name':'Bar'}],
  73. 'markers': [dict(name="Portals", filterFunction=placeFilter),
  74. dict(name="Players", filterFunction=playerIcons)]
  75. }
  76. grzesiek11@starypc:~$
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ement